After Kentucky and Tennessee combined to hit 12 home runs in the first two games of the series, the Volunteers used pitching, defense and small-ball to claim a 3-1 victory over the Wildcats on a hot and humid Sunday afternoon at Lindsey Nelson Stadium. The win gives UT its second straight Southeastern Conference series victory as it has now won four of its last five league contests.
